I do mine with paints4u stuff, comes mixed with paint and lacquer and artists brush.

I clean the stonechip, or stonechips with thinners, paint it so its like a blob, flat it back with 3000 grit wet and dry then machine polish over, if theres loads and its random road rash ill wipe a paint/lacquer soaked microfibre across the panel in question leave it to go hard for a few days flat it back then machine that up. works wonders :)

I imagine with chipex all the blending solution does is wipe away the excess so you dont get the blob of paint, i bet it still doesnt look as shiny and un noticeable as my method :) lol

Shame your not closer, i did a whole stone spattered wing at the weekend, that had been left all week to harden, i just prepared the panel so it was clean and wax/polish free, wiped a microfibre cloth soaked with the correct colour/lacquer over it and left it, flatted it back with 2000 grit then polished it back up with my DA 6 pro and menz cut pad with menz fg500 polish. never knew it had been done ! :D
